Beginning Jazz Piano - An Introduction to Swing, Blues, Latin and Funk Part 1 - Everything You Need to Get Started This book is aimed at players with some piano experience who wish to develop a grasp of the basic tools required to play and improvise in a jazz style. It includes many unique features and resources to kick start your journey: 19 pieces spanning a range of styles, taking you in easy steps from one chord only, to tunes with three chords Each piece includes a simple BASS LINE for a friend or teacher, to help you keep the flow and play with a consistent groove Downloadable AUDIO FILES of every piece, featuring examples of improvised solos BACKING tracks with bass and drums only, for when you're by yourself 'REPLAY' tracks for most pieces, featuring scrollable music and adjustable tempos Unique 'SING & PLAY' tracks to help you develop your aural skills and improvise with pentatonic scales Insight into basic jazz harmony and improvisation techniques, including scales, chords an d left-hand shapes Invaluable SUGGESTED LISTENING sections in each chapter, focusing on tunes with one, two or three chords only This is the ideal book to use with your piano teacher, but the backing and 'Replay' tracks make it equally accessible to those studying on their own.
